The 'Middle Earth Roleplaying Project' aims to recreate J.R.R. Tolkien's Middle Earth in the Creation engine of 'Skyrim'. The player will be plunged into Middle Earth near the end of the Third Age, not long before the War of the Ring breaks out.

Description

Helms Deep model by ztree, environment design by Enagan and retextures of the mountain rocks and some other environmental textures by me (Maegfaer).

Still WIP.
